dcterms.abstractSingapore Airlines (SIA), renowned for service excellence and innovation, faces new challenges despite record profits in FY2024/25. Increased competition, rising costs, and reliance on fare promotions threaten profitability and brand exclusivity. Major investments in premium products, digital transformation, and international partnerships require careful execution to sustain SIA’s premium positioning and long-term growth.-
